Nobody's Fool

"In a town where nothing ever happens... everything is about to happen to Sully."

1994
1h 50m
6.9(318 votes)
Drama
Comedy

Overview

A rascally nearing-retirement man juggles a workers' compensation suit while secretly working for his nemesis and flirting with his nemesis' young wife. As his estranged son returns, he faces new family responsibilities, while a banker plots to evict him from his home.
